Tyre Sampson, 14, fell last Thursday ... • From 1987 to 2000, there were an estimated 4.5 amusement ride-related deaths per year. • From 1990 to 2004, there were 52 deaths associated with amusement park rides (3.7 per year). • Every day from May through September in each year between 1990–2010 had an average of 20 injuries by amusement park guests under 18 years of age that required hospitalization.

WebEvil Whirl at Disney World Florida (2007) On November 23 rd, 2007, a female employee at Disney World Florida was in a restricted area of the platform of the "Primeval Whirl". Suddenly, the 63-year-old woman fell and was struck by one of the rides vehicles, causing traumatic brain injuries. Unfortunately, the employee died in hospital 4 days later. WebIn July 1984, a 46-year-old woman was riding the Rail Blazer roller coaster when she was flung from the ride and fell 20 feet (6.1 m) to her death. Park officials claimed that the woman fainted and fell out of the car, but her husband, who had been beside her, said that she had not fainted but had simply been tossed from the ride when it whipped around a …

Tuesday was such big emotional roller ... canine divine birch bayWeb12 dec. 2011 · Overall, the risk of injury while riding a roller coaster is very low. In the U.S. people take about 900 million rides per year, and only about 1 in 124,000 result in an injury. However, studies show that between the years 1994-2004 there were 40 deaths from roller coasters total, and currently the annual death rate is about 4 per year in the U.S.A. canine digit amputation surgeryWeb25 nov. 2016 · Roller Coaster Death: Five amusement park deaths that will shock roller coaster fans 1.
